Default The 19th Century: Is it available for $100 or less???

Posted By: Dave

My advice is to buy ungraded Old Judge cards. I have found that prices seem to skyrocket for graded cards no matter what the grade. For instance, I bought a $10,000 Kelly card for $150 from an antique store here where I live. The card would have probably been graded in the 3-4 range by PSA. That same card can sell for thousands after it's received the 4 grade. I like to collect Pittsburgh, Cincinnati, and Louisville players from the Old Judge set, and have had a lot of luck buying privately from other collectors, and buying from the local antique shops. the cards I pick up mnow and again on ebay I probably overpay for, and I have been shill bid on several N172 auctions since Christmas time.
